容器化部署与编排:技术驱动的高效运维新范式
|
AI辅助生成图,仅供参考 随着云计算和微服务架构的普及,传统的部署方式逐渐暴露出效率低、维护复杂等问题。容器化技术的出现,为应用的部署和管理带来了革命性的变化。通过将应用及其依赖打包成一个轻量级的容器,开发者可以确保应用在不同环境中的一致性,从而减少“在我机器上能运行”的问题。容器不仅提高了部署的灵活性,还简化了开发、测试和生产环境之间的差异。Docker 是目前最流行的容器化工具之一,它允许开发者快速构建、发布和运行应用。配合 Docker Hub 等镜像仓库,团队可以高效地共享和管理容器镜像,提升整体协作效率。 然而,单个容器的管理并不足以应对复杂的生产环境。当应用由多个微服务组成时,如何协调这些容器的启动、停止、扩展和监控成为关键问题。这时,编排工具如 Kubernetes 就显得尤为重要。Kubernetes 提供了自动化部署、扩展和管理容器化应用的能力,使运维工作更加高效和可靠。 通过容器编排,企业可以实现资源的动态分配和负载均衡,提高系统的可用性和弹性。同时,编排工具还支持自动故障恢复和滚动更新,减少了人工干预的需求,提升了运维的自动化水平。 容器化与编排的结合,正在重塑现代软件开发和运维的模式。它不仅提升了部署效率,还为企业提供了更高的灵活性和可扩展性。随着技术的不断进步,这种新范式将在未来发挥更大的作用,推动企业向更高效的数字化转型迈进。 (编辑:51站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

